SP5000 can store maintenance and a variety of other tools. To perform maintenance, you used to have to bring a PC, open the control panel, look for the controller and connect a cable. Lack of space to even put the computer down meant that you frequently debugged with the PC on your lap. With SP5000, the HMI usually used as a control terminal serves the role of a PC at times to reduce workload during maintenance. You can also combine with the Pro-face Remote HMI to remotely monitor and control applications. To monitor using a tablet, for example, you can start the HMI screen with a PLC program tool.

Computers are useful for general-purpose applications, but needed an uninterruptible power supply or similar measures in case of a sudden power interruption. SP5000 is fitted with a data backup NVRAM to protect histrical data in the event of a sudden power interruption. Power can be turned off in the same way as the normal HMI even without executing shutdown processes like a computer.

Modular construction and storage mounts included for the main unit make maintenance easy to perform with SP5000 in a short amount of time. For example, by replacing the display unit alone or just the box, you can eliminate the costs for spare parts. Also, since box replacement entails simply replacing the data media (SD/CFast), anyone can do the job.

Production loss can be minimized with "Alarm Analysis" function
When an error occurs, an operator can easily seek and check the condition on-site, just by touching the alarm message to call up various error-related data in chronological order. An alarm analysis screen with timing chart of alarm-related device addresses can be simply configured only through a few steps on GP-Pro EX software for easy troubleshooting, debugging and/or design changes of production equipment to reduce downtime for enhanced productivity.

Programing function relieves PLC memory burden
GP-Pro EX supports logic programs, which let you create programs in a familiar ladder program format, and D-Script, a proprietary scripting language that offers similar functionality to sophisticated programming languages. This lowers the burden placed on the PLC and enables high-level screen design.
Logic Program - Program with a familiar ladder language
Screens and logic programming can be edited with the same software, so editing between parts and logic elements can be performed via drag and drop. Controller addresses can be directly written, allowing you to reduce development time.
*The online editing function allows you to make program changes on a computer during operation. You can make changes in a program without stopping operation - even while the control function is in operation. This enables work efficiency at startup and during maintenance.
D-Script - Create programs with our unique simplified language
Configure these settings based on trigger conditions including "Continuous Action", "Timer Bit Change", and "Condition Satisfied". Many functions are also provided including search
(search and replace strings in the script) and debug functions (display messages and addresses on the unit).
D-Scripts created with GP-PRO/PBIII can be used unmodified so replacement is a breeze.

*7 The front face of the GP unit, installed in a solid panel, has been tested using, conditions equivalent to the standards shown in the specification. Even though the, GP unit's level of resistance is equivalent to these standards, oils that should have, no effect on the GP can possibly harm the unit. This can occur in areas where either, vaporized oils are present, or where low viscosity cutting oils are allowed to adhere, to the unit for long periods of time. If the GP's front face protection sheet becomes, peeled off, these conditions can lead to the ingress of oil into the GP and separate, protection measures are suggested., Also, if non-approved oils are present, it may cause deformation or corrosion of the, front panel’s plastic cover. Therefore, prior to installing the GP be sure to confirm the, type of conditions that will be present in the GP's operating environment., If the installation gasket is used for a long period of time, or if the unit and its gasket, are removed from the panel, the original level of the protection cannot be guaranteed. To maintain the original protection level, be sure to replace the installation gasket, regularly.
